LD2982AM25R belongs to the category of voltage regulators.
It is primarily used for regulating voltage in electronic circuits.
The LD2982AM25R comes in a small surface-mount package.
The essence of LD2982AM25R lies in its ability to provide stable and regulated voltage output.

The LD2982AM25R operates based on the principle of voltage regulation. It takes an input voltage and provides a stable output voltage, regardless of any fluctuations in the input voltage. This is achieved through internal circuitry that adjusts the voltage to maintain a constant level at the output.
The LD2982AM25R finds applications in various electronic devices and systems, including but not limited to: - Battery-powered devices - Portable electronics - Automotive electronics - Industrial control systems - Communication equipment

Q: What is LD2982AM25R? A: LD2982AM25R is a low dropout voltage regulator IC that provides a fixed output voltage of 2.5V.
Q: What is the maximum input voltage for LD2982AM25R? A: The maximum input voltage for LD2982AM25R is 16V.
Q: What is the dropout voltage of LD2982AM25R? A: The dropout voltage of LD2982AM25R is typically around 300mV at 100mA load current.
Q: Can LD2982AM25R handle high current loads? A: No, LD2982AM25R is designed for low current applications with a maximum output current of 100mA.
Q: Is LD2982AM25R suitable for battery-powered devices? A: Yes, LD2982AM25R is an ideal choice for battery-powered devices due to its low dropout voltage and low quiescent current.
Q: Does LD2982AM25R require any external components for operation? A: Yes, LD2982AM25R requires input and output capacitors for stability and proper operation.
Q: What is the operating temperature range of LD2982AM25R? A: The operating temperature range of LD2982AM25R is typically -40°C to +125°C.
